Overview:
Serves as a member of the Management Development Program (MDP) and participates in ten weeks of Core Training and one year of On-the-Job (OJT) training. Core Training responsibilities include participation in classroom training, observations of departmental presentations, interaction with senior management, peer networking, and working in teams on two group project assignments. OJT responsibilities vary by department and are assigned by the department manager. The position may be responsible for additional projects as assigned by the department manager or Leadership Development Manager-MDP.
Department Description:
The Corporate Communications Team serves as the central hub for content development, reputational management, executive messaging, social media presence, enterprise and business line communication strategies, and public relations and financial communications. We support the organization as communications advisors, partners, storytellers, content creators, and cross-collaborating experts to create holistic, purpose-driven messages, campaigns, and content that resonate with audiences.
This role offers broad exposure to the bank, with opportunities to learn about our lines of business, cross-collaborate in many working groups, and explore communication tools hands-on. You’ll help shape how we connect with internal and external audiences through content creation, campaign support, and social media channel management.
Department Responsibilities:
- Support the development and delivery of clear, consistent messaging that fosters understanding, alignment, and culture across the organization.
- Assist in designing and executing social media communications, including short-term deliverables and long-term campaigns across owned, paid, and earned channels.
- Draft, edit, and publish content across platforms and channels, translating business outcomes into compelling storytelling features.
- May contribute to content creation while assisting in overall content production efforts including storyboard, shoot and edit videos using editing software.
- Conduct quarterly research and benchmarking using internal data and industry insights to inform social media strategy and assess the competitive landscape.
- Monitor engagement metrics and prepare performance reports to evaluate campaign effectiveness and guide future content decisions.
- Learn and use back-end workflow tools such as Sprinklr, Jira, and Workfront to manage content calendars and support campaign delivery across email and intranet platforms.
- Support ad-hoc communications projects, including executive messaging, press releases, speechwriting, and experimentation with emerging technologies like AI to improve communication effectiveness.
